About your Active Vocabulary and the Backup Dictionary

About your Active Vocabulary

Your Active Vocabulary is a word repository that Dragon loads into your computer’s random access memory for immediate use. These are words that Dragon assumes you are more likely to use during dictation. When you add new words, Dragon moves the words that have not been used recently from your Active Vocabulary to your Backup Dictionary.

About the Backup Dictionary

The Backup Dictionary is an additional repository of words that you use less frequently. You move words from the Backup Dictionary to your Active Vocabulary when you do the following:

  • Use Learn from specific documents.
  • Use Learn from Sent emails.
  • Import lists of words or phrases.
  • Correct errors using the Correction Menu.
  • Correct errors using your mouse and keyboard.
  • Spell words using the Spelling Window.
